In Ashdown, AR, Financial Assistance for Families Working in the Restaurant Industry is dedicated to supporting food and beverage service employees facing financial hardships due to illness or medical emergencies. We provide essential financial assistance that covers necessary expenses such as rent or mortgage, utilities, medical bills and supplies, travel costs for hospital visits, and childcare needs including diapers and formula. Our mission is to alleviate the stress of unexpected financial burdens, ensuring families can focus on their health and well-being. While former recipients may reapply for support after a 12-month waiting period, we maintain a lifetime assistance cap of $7,500 to ensure we can help as many families as possible in their time of need.

At Food Stamp Assistance in Ashdown, AR, we are dedicated to helping individuals and families navigate the Food Stamp process with compassion and care. We serve as a vital resource, ensuring everyone can access essential food assistance without the added stress often associated with poverty. Our program provides support in applying for government benefits like SNAP, offering a straightforward screener that can be accessed by texting FOOD (or COMIDA for Spanish) to 74544. If you qualify, we guide you through the application process, making it simpler and more accessible. We also collaborate with community partners to assist with completing applications over the phone in select states, reinforcing our commitment to providing emergency food support to those in need. The Ovarian Cancer Treatment Fund, based in Ashdown, AR, is dedicated to enhancing the accessibility of vital resources for ovarian cancer patients. We provide a one-time financial assistance payment of $1,000 to approved patients to help cover essential non-medical expenses such as transportation to treatment, rent, utility bills, groceries, childcare, and household cleaning services. Our mission is to alleviate the burden of these costs, ensuring that patients can focus on their health and recovery. Eligibility varies by state, and we work diligently to verify this during the application process, offering support where it is needed most to empower those affected by ovarian cancer.

Located in Ashdown, AR, Financial Assistance Funds is dedicated to supporting families with children who have special health care needs by providing essential financial assistance. Our program offers much-needed funds that can be directed toward a variety of expenses, including medical costs such as prescriptions and durable medical equipment, as well as non-medical needs like home and vehicle modifications, clothing, and diapers. Recognizing the holistic needs of families, we also address healthcare-related expenses such as travel, lodging, and transportation costs to medical facilities. Daily living expenses, including food and utilities, are also considered within our support framework. Grants are available up to $500 per family each year, with a streamlined review process to ensure timely assistance. We encourage families in need to submit their requests, which are reviewed in the order received, ensuring that we prioritize the urgent needs of the community we serve.
